Join FlipAndroid.COM Telegram Group: https://t.me/joinchat/F_aqThGkhwcLzmI49vKAiw


Tag: Gradle

Sabores de un proyecto

Quiero construir diferentes sabores de un proyecto (sólo las carpetas res tienen diferentes contenidos), pero no funciona. Así que aquí está mi archivo build.gradle (como en esta pregunta Custom antigua estructura del proyecto Android en Gradle ): buildscript { repositories { mavenCentral() } dependencies { classpath 'com.android.tools.build:gradle:0.4' } } apply plugin: 'android' dependencies { compile […]

Android Studio Gradle en el servidor

He instalado Android Studio y gradle según sea necesario pero al crear un nuevo proyecto recibo este error com.intellij.openapi.options.ConfigurationException: Failed to import new Gradle project: Could not fetch model of type 'IdeaProject' using Gradle distribution 'http://services.gradle.org/distributions/gradle-1.6-bin.zip'. Unable to start the daemon process. This problem might be caused by incorrect configuration of the daemon. For example, […]

Robolectric + Gradle falla cuando se inicia la prueba

No puedo ejecutar pruebas con Robolectric, cuando intento ejecutar las pruebas: ./gradlew test Tengo la siguiente excepción: com.Makeupalley.test.HomeRobolectricTest > initializationError FAILED java.lang.NoClassDefFoundError Caused by: java.lang.ClassNotFoundException java.lang.NoClassDefFoundError: android/app/Activity at java.lang.ClassLoader.defineClass1(Native Method) at java.lang.ClassLoader.defineClass(ClassLoader.java:800) . . . Caused by: java.lang.ClassNotFoundException: android.app.Activity at java.net.URLClassLoader$1.run(URLClassLoader.java:366) at java.net.URLClassLoader$1.run(URLClassLoader.java:355) La prueba falla con cualquier asert como esto: assertTrue (true). Este es […]

La sugerencia de código en src / test no funciona en Android Studio

Estoy usando Android Studio 0.3.5, y estoy teniendo un problema donde la sugerencia de código en src/test directamente no está funcionando. Cada vez que escribo clases de Robolectric, mockito o JUnit en cualquiera de los archivos en src/test , no me da una sugerencia de código como lo hace en el directorio src/main . En […]

AppCompat V7 falla al usar shrinkResources

He habilitado la nueva herramienta shrinkResources en mi proyecto gradle y falla debido a no encontrar un AppCompat color xml, probablemente eliminado por la herramienta. 11-03 11:30:19.095: E/AndroidRuntime(24797): Caused by: android.content.res.Resources$NotFoundException: File res/color/abc_primary_text_material_dark.xml from color state list resource ID #0x7f090192 11-03 11:30:19.095: E/AndroidRuntime(24797): at android.content.res.Resources.loadColorStateList(Resources.java:2247) 11-03 11:30:19.095: E/AndroidRuntime(24797): at android.content.res.Resources.getColor(Resources.java:812) 11-03 11:30:19.095: E/AndroidRuntime(24797): at android.support.v7.internal.widget.TintManager.getThemeAttrColor(TintManager.java:325) […]

¿Existe un equivalente de aspectoj-maven-plugin para gradle que funciona en android?

Trabajando con maven y un proyecto de Java puro, pude usar el aspecto de aspecto de codehaus-maven-plugin para tejer (tiempo de compilación) aspectos (de una biblioteca que construyo) en mis clases anotadas. Me gustaría hacer lo mismo con un proyecto de Android (gradle build), pero parece que no puedo encontrar mucha documentación. He encontrado el […]

Explicar la estrategia de dependencias transitivas descrita en la documentación de Android Build System

¿Puede alguien explicar lo que el equipo de herramientas de Android significa en este breve párrafo citado a continuación? Específicamente: ¿Qué es "somelib.jar"? ¿Están sugiriendo que creo un nuevo subproyecto que sólo tiene dependencias, lo llamo "projectA" y luego el proyecto publica "projectA.jar"? (Usando artifacts.add ("default", archivo ('projectA.jar')) El comportamiento deseado que quiero es publicar […]

Problema al auto-incrementar versionCode con Gradle

Estoy tratando de configurar las variantes de construcción de mi aplicación, como parte de la migración de Ant a Gradle. La estructura que me ocurrió es la siguiente: main |-> monkey Quiero una forma de auto incrementar el código de la versión para el sabor 'mono', entre otras cosas. He duplicado el AndroidManifest, por lo […]

Android Studio – Gradle: La ejecución falló para la tarea ': Foo: dexDebug' – pero ¿por qué?

Recibo este error: Gradle: Execution failed for task ':Foo:dexDebug'. Y desde 2 días! Tengo intentar un montón de solución … Pero nada funciona bien! De Verdad ! Necesitas ayuda ! Trabajo con android Studio. (IntelliJ IDEA) Para este siguiente directorio tres FooProject [RootProject] |-gradle |-libraries |-facebook [library1] |-libs |-android-support-v4.jar |-res |-*.(drawable…) |-src |-*.java |-build.gradle |-AnroidManifest.xml […]

Gradle Build tipo de personalización para diferentes sabores

Estoy tratando de especificar tipos de construcción para cada uno de mis sabores gradle. Así que la estructura sería android { productFlavors { flavor1 { buildTypes { debug { packageNameSuffix ".flavor1" versionNameSuffix "flavor1" } release { packageNameSuffix ".flavor1" versionNameSuffix "flavor1" signingConfig signingConfigs.foo } } } flavor2 { buildTypes { debug {} release { signingConfig signingConfigs.bar […]

F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.